To all equestrians who love riding in the Galisteo Basin Preserve:
The last few years have seen tremendous improvements and expansion of the trails in the Preserve. Operations and stewardship activities are supported financially by grants from REI, annual fundraising campaigns, and generous donations from various trail user groups. Equestrians’ visible participation in actual trail building and maintenance has improved relations with cyclists and hikers immensely and made us welcomed users. To date, approximately $69,000, or 86%, has been raised toward the $80,000 goal for 2017.
